The Red Mass, a historical tradition within the Catholic Church, is held on the Sunday before the opening session of the Supreme Court.

some French. Military tribunals: In Hamdan
v. Rumsfeld, Roberts was part of a unanimous panel overturning
the district court
ruling and upholding military
tribunals set up by the Bush administration for trying
terrorism suspects
known as enemy
combatants.
2. the Third Geneva Convention is a treaty between nations and as such it does not confer individual rights and remedies enforceable in U.S. courts; 3. even if the Convention could be enforced in U.S. courts, it would not be of assistance to Hamdan at the time because, for a conflict such as the war against al-Qaeda (considered by the court as a separate war from that against Afghanistan itself) that is not between two countries, it guarantees only a certain standard of judicial procedure without speaking to the jurisdiction in which the prisoner must be tried. The court held open the possibility of judicial review of the results
of the military commission after the current proceedings have ended. [13]
This decision was overturned on June 29, 2006 by the Supreme Court in
a
5-3 decision, with Roberts not participating due to his prior ruling
as a circuit judge.

The College of the Holy Cross is an exclusively undergraduate Roman
Catholic college located in Worcester,
Massachusetts, USA.
Holy Cross is the oldest Roman
Catholic college in New England and one
of the oldest in the United States. Opened as a school for boys under
the auspices of the Society
of Jesus, it was the first Jesuit
college in New England.

![]() Educated at Princeton University and Yale Law School, Alito served as U.S. Attorney for the District of New Jersey and a judge on the United States Court of Appeals for the Third Circuit prior to joining the Supreme Court. He is the 110th justice, the second Italian American and the eleventh Roman Catholic to serve on the court. |
